diff --git a/share/pdf2htmlEX.js.in b/share/pdf2htmlEX.js.in
index 9555913..809b4b4 100644
--- a/share/pdf2htmlEX.js.in
+++ b/share/pdf2htmlEX.js.in
@@ -340,7 +340,6 @@ var pdf2htmlEX = (function(){
else {
_.$container.scrollTop(_.$container.scrollTop()-_.$container.height());
}
- e.preventDefault();
break;
case 34: // Page DOWN
@@ -352,23 +351,28 @@ var pdf2htmlEX = (function(){
else {
_.$container.scrollTop(_.$container.scrollTop()+_.$container.height());
}
- e.preventDefault();
break;
case 35: // End
if (e.ctrlKey) {
_.scroll_to_page(_.pages[_.pages.length-1]);
- e.preventDefault();
}
+ else
+ return;
break;
case 36: // Home
if (e.ctrlKey) {
_.scroll_to_page(_.pages[1]);
- e.preventDefault();
}
+ else
+ return;
break;
+
+ default:
+ return;
}
+ e.preventDefault();
});
},